KINBURN SPIT — For centuries, the physics of amphibious warfare dictated a brutal calculus: taking ground from a fortified coast required trading human lives for every yard of sand. From the shores of Gallipoli to the blood-soaked beaches of Normandy, the most perilous mission any commander could order was an assault against a dug-in enemy waiting behind a seawall.
On a pitch-black night along the Black Sea, that calculus was fundamentally shattered.
An unmanned surface vessel glided silently across open water toward the Kinburn Spit—a strategically vital, heavily fortified strip of sand guarding the entrance to Ukraine’s key ports. The vessel’s front ramp lowered onto the shore, but no Marines stormed the beach. No boots touched the wet sand. Instead, a treaded, remote-controlled ground combat robot rolled down the ramp, pushed into the tree line, and opened fire with a heavy machine gun on Russian positions. Its mission complete, the boat reversed back into the dark sea.
